Grant Overview
Research initiatives in innovative teaching tools funded by grants focus on advancing educational outcomes through scientifically-backed methodologies. These grants cover a spectrum of activities including developing technology-enhanced learning tools, pilot programs for specialized educational interventions, and assessments of their impact on various learner demographics. Notably, the funding does not support projects lacking a defined research component or those that focus solely on curriculum development without integrating new technological methodologies.
A practical illustration of this funding's use is a collaborative project between a tech startup and an educational institution, designed to create an interactive learning application that engages students in geometry through gamified experiences. Initial pilot studies indicated improved learning retention rates among students who used the app versus traditional methods. Another example would involve a university conducting research to analyze the efficacy of virtual reality simulations in science classes, measuring student engagement and knowledge retention against conventional teaching methods.
Applicants ideally include educational institutions, research organizations, and educational technology innovators. However, proposals lacking a clear research design, those focused only on product marketing rather than educational development, or projects without measurable outcomes will not be considered for funding. Effective applicants must articulate how their research aligns with contemporary educational challenges and technological innovations that address those needs.
Emerging trends in education emphasize a data-driven approach to teaching, necessitating innovative solutions that support diverse learning experiences. As such, aligning grant proposals with current prioritiessuch as personalized learning solutions and hybrid instruction modalitieswill enhance competitiveness. Successful proposals must outline how they will gather and analyze data not only during the intervention but also post-implementation to evaluate long-term impacts on learning outcomes.
Evaluation and reporting requirements for grantees will include establishing specific benchmarks related to educational improvements, which could be assessed through standardized test scores, student feedback, and engagement metrics. Grants will require documentation on the dissemination of findings to ensure the educational community can benefit from the insights gained during research. Common pitfalls include the failure to establish realistic timelines for research phases and inadequate budget allocation for necessary tools or manpower.
In conclusion, this grant program is dedicated to cultivating innovative research in educational technologies that show quantifiable benefits. By focusing on measurable outcomes and effective research designs, it holds the potential to transform educational practices across diverse learning environments while excluding unsupported technological or educational initiatives.
